I just saw my first American Woodcock the other night
when I stayed out way past my bedtime of 7 p.m. We
drove home and pulled into the driveway and we saw a
really unusual bird w/ the long bill. My husband and
I both studied it, it flew into the air-straight up
almost. We waited until it flew away. When we got up
to the house I checked the field guide and made
positive I.D. I haven't had much time to look for
birds lately, so its really nice to when they find me
(ha!)

> Just the other day I was thinking it was about time
> to go
> look for displaying Woodcock. Then, last night, I
> was
> leaving work at the NTRC off of Pellissippi in west
> Knox
> Co. and had just stepped out the door when I was
> stopped
> dead in my tracks by the unmistakeable "PEENT" of a
> Woodcock.
> I just caught a glimpse as he flew by. I dropped my
> bag
> at the door and walked over to the large field
> across from
> the gas station/KFC/Taco Bell where I was able to
> watch and
> listen to three to four displaying males. Too cool!
